For the Techie…

On our current trip to the Caribbean, SVV banned my laptop (cue panic attack!) as he wanted me to be “more present” for a change. However, he did allow me to bring our iPad so I could check in with my clients from port, and we also had both of our iPhones on hand. Given that we’re in a cruise cabin with limited outlets—bear in mind, we also have to charge our various camera batteries—this Sharper Image travel charging valet has really come in handy. It allows us to charge three Apple devices at once, and it folds up all cute and compact-like so it doesn’t get all jumbled up and lost in our luggage. Plus, it comes with a car adapter, so you better believe I’ll be using this little guy on future road trips.

For the Girly Girl…

Perhaps I’m getting too intimate here, or perhaps you’re going to thank me, but I have yet to find any underwear that is more comfortable for traveling than Hanky Panky boyshorts. I once thought it ridiculous to spend $30 on one pair of underwear, but now I’ve thrown out everything else I own (Victoria’s Secret, Patagonia, you name it) in favor of these bad boys. (Tip: Rue La La does a couple random Hanky Panky sales throughout the year, so I get much of my stock half off via them. Subscribe to their emails, so you’ll be alerted of all upcoming sales before they happen—particularly because the Hanky Panky shops always sell out within hours of going live.)
